Nickel 200 vs. EN 1.4592 Stainless Steel

Nickel 200 belongs to the nickel alloys classification, while EN 1.4592 stainless steel belongs to the iron alloys. There are 30 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(4,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is nickel 200 and the bottom bar is EN 1.4592 stainless steel.
